? Frequently asked questions

Moving from Porto to San Antonio: cheaper or more expensive?

Moving from Porto to San Antonio, your cost of living will be roughly 6% more expensive. San Antonio’s cost-of-living index is 94 versus 88 for Porto (US = 100). Use the salary tool above to see the income you’d need to keep the same lifestyle.

Is Porto cheaper than San Antonio?

San Antonio is about 6% more expensive than Porto overall — its cost-of-living index is 94 versus 88 for Porto.

How much do you need to earn in San Antonio to live like in Porto?

To keep the same standard of living, a $75,000 salary in Porto is worth about $79,622 in San Antonio. Enter your own figure in the calculator above.

Which has lower taxes, Porto or San Antonio?

United States has the lower top income-tax rate — 37% versus 48% in Portugal.
